服务器测试环境要求有哪些,深入解析服务器测试环境要求,构建高效稳定的服务器系统
- 综合资讯
- 2024-11-22 11:18:36
- 2

服务器测试环境需满足硬件配置、网络条件、软件配置、安全性和可扩展性等要求。深入解析这些要素,可构建出高效稳定的服务器系统,保障服务器性能与安全性。...
服务器测试环境需满足硬件配置、网络条件、软件配置、安全性和可扩展性等要求。深入解析这些要素,可构建出高效稳定的服务器系统,保障服务器性能与安全性。
随着互联网技术的飞速发展,服务器在各个领域都扮演着至关重要的角色,为了保证服务器系统的稳定、高效运行,对服务器测试环境的要求越来越高,本文将详细解析服务器测试环境的要求,旨在帮助读者构建高效稳定的服务器系统。
服务器测试环境要求
1、硬件要求
(1)服务器主机:服务器主机应具备高性能、高稳定性的特点,满足业务需求,具体要求如下:
- CPU:建议采用多核心、高性能的CPU,如Intel Xeon系列或AMD EPYC系列。
- 内存:根据业务需求,选择合适的内存容量,一般建议8GB以上,根据业务规模可适当增加。
- 存储:硬盘选择高速、大容量的固态硬盘(SSD)或混合硬盘(SSD+HDD),提高数据读写速度。
- 网卡:选择高速、稳定的网卡,如千兆或万兆网卡,满足高速数据传输需求。
(2)网络设备:服务器测试环境中的网络设备应具备以下特点:
- 稳定性:选择知名品牌的网络设备,确保网络连接稳定。
- 高速性:支持高速数据传输,如千兆或万兆网络。
- 可扩展性:支持虚拟化、堆叠等特性,方便后期扩展。
2、软件要求
(1)操作系统:选择稳定、安全的操作系统,如Linux(CentOS、Ubuntu)或Windows Server。
- 系统稳定性:操作系统应具备良好的稳定性,减少系统崩溃、重启等故障。
- 安全性:操作系统应具备较强的安全性,防止恶意攻击、病毒等威胁。
- 兼容性:操作系统应与服务器硬件、网络设备等兼容。
(2)数据库:根据业务需求选择合适的数据库,如MySQL、Oracle、SQL Server等。
- 数据库稳定性:数据库应具备良好的稳定性,确保数据安全。
- 数据库性能:数据库应具备较高的性能,满足业务需求。
- 数据库兼容性:数据库应与操作系统、服务器硬件等兼容。
(3)中间件:根据业务需求选择合适的中间件,如Tomcat、WebLogic、IIS等。
- 中间件稳定性:中间件应具备良好的稳定性,减少系统崩溃、重启等故障。
- 中间件性能:中间件应具备较高的性能,满足业务需求。
- 中间件兼容性:中间件应与操作系统、数据库等兼容。
3、环境配置要求
(1)网络配置:服务器测试环境中的网络配置应满足以下要求:
- IP地址规划:合理规划IP地址,确保网络连接稳定。
- 子网掩码:选择合适的子网掩码,提高网络安全性。
- 网关:配置正确的网关,实现网络通信。
(2)系统配置:服务器测试环境中的系统配置应满足以下要求:
- 时区设置:根据业务需求设置合适的时区。
- 语言设置:选择合适的语言,方便运维人员操作。
- 用户权限:合理分配用户权限,确保系统安全。
4、监控与日志
(1)监控系统:选择合适的监控系统,如Nagios、Zabbix等,实时监控服务器性能、网络状态、系统资源等。
(2)日志系统:配置完善的日志系统,记录系统运行过程中的关键信息,便于故障排查。
服务器测试环境对服务器系统的稳定、高效运行至关重要,本文详细解析了服务器测试环境的要求,包括硬件、软件、环境配置和监控等方面,通过满足这些要求,可以构建一个高效稳定的服务器系统,为业务发展提供有力保障。
本文链接:https://www.zhitaoyun.cn/1000448.html
发表评论